OF CHRISTELL, ye 1. Cap. 7.
Christell ye first, succeidit to Maister Adame Setoun his father, quha
mareit Mauld Percie, dochter to Ingrahame Percie, and deit in the 30
yeir of Alexander the Thrid. This Christell was moir geuin to deuotioun
nor wardlines.
OF CHRISTELL, ye 2. Cap. 8.
Christell Setoun, the secund of that name, succeidit to Christell the
first, his father, quha mareit Agnes, dochter to Patrick Earle of Marche,
in the tyme of Alexander the Thrid, and was ane noble man, and did
monie goode acts against ye Inglishmen, quhen ye croun was desolat, and
in pley betwixt ye Bruce and the Balioll. Quhilk Christell, quhen he might
not brooke ye landis in Louthiane, quhair he was duelling, he duelt in
Jedburgh forrest, ay waiting his tyme contrair ye Inglishmen, quhair w'
fourtie of his kin and freinds he defeit and vincust eight scoir of Inglish-
men, as may be sein in Wallace buik at mair lenth. He deit in ye tyme
of Williame Wallace.
